How an astrophysicist uses Codex to help simulate black holes

· Source: OpenAI Blog

An astrophysicist is utilizing the Codex tool to develop black hole simulations, enabling scientists to study extreme physics and rigorously test the fundamental principles of Einstein’s theory of general relativity. This is possible due to Codex’s ability to assist in creating complex models that simulate the behavior of these cosmic phenomena. The simulation of black holes is a research area that demands a substantial amount of calculations and precise models, and tools like Codex can be crucial in advancing this field. Research in this area may have significant implications for our understanding of the universe and the laws that govern it.
